Rule 1: For Every Result, Keep Track of How It Was Produced
Rule 2: Avoid Manual Data Manipulation Steps
Rule 3: Archive the Exact Versions of All External Programs Used
Rule 4: Version Control All Custom Scripts
Rule 5: Record All Intermediate Results, When Possible in Standardized Formats
Rule 6: For Analyses That Include Randomness, Note Underlying Random Seeds
Rule 7: Always Store Raw Data behind Plots
Rule 8: Generate Hierarchical Analysis Output, Allowing Layers of Increasing Detail to Be Inspected
Rule 9: Connect Textual Statements to Underlying Results
Rule 10: Provide Public Access to Scripts, Runs, and Results
%0 Journal Article
%1 10.1371/journal.pcbi.1003285
%A Sandve, Geir Kjetil
%A Nekrutenko, Anton
%A Taylor, James
%A Hovig, Eivind
%D 2013
%I Public Library of Science
%J PLOS Computational Biology
%K forschungsdaten litQSaFE medizin reproducibility software softwareLizenzMotivation
%N 10
%P 1-4
%R 10.1371/journal.pcbi.1003285
%T Ten Simple Rules for Reproducible Computational Research
%U https://doi.org/10.1371/journal.pcbi.1003285
%V 9
%X Rule 1: For Every Result, Keep Track of How It Was Produced
Rule 2: Avoid Manual Data Manipulation Steps
Rule 3: Archive the Exact Versions of All External Programs Used
Rule 4: Version Control All Custom Scripts
Rule 5: Record All Intermediate Results, When Possible in Standardized Formats
Rule 6: For Analyses That Include Randomness, Note Underlying Random Seeds
Rule 7: Always Store Raw Data behind Plots
Rule 8: Generate Hierarchical Analysis Output, Allowing Layers of Increasing Detail to Be Inspected
Rule 9: Connect Textual Statements to Underlying Results
Rule 10: Provide Public Access to Scripts, Runs, and Results
@article{10.1371/journal.pcbi.1003285,
abstract = {Rule 1: For Every Result, Keep Track of How It Was Produced
Rule 2: Avoid Manual Data Manipulation Steps
Rule 3: Archive the Exact Versions of All External Programs Used
Rule 4: Version Control All Custom Scripts
Rule 5: Record All Intermediate Results, When Possible in Standardized Formats
Rule 6: For Analyses That Include Randomness, Note Underlying Random Seeds
Rule 7: Always Store Raw Data behind Plots
Rule 8: Generate Hierarchical Analysis Output, Allowing Layers of Increasing Detail to Be Inspected
Rule 9: Connect Textual Statements to Underlying Results
Rule 10: Provide Public Access to Scripts, Runs, and Results},
added-at = {2017-09-12T13:18:39.000+0200},
author = {Sandve, Geir Kjetil and Nekrutenko, Anton and Taylor, James and Hovig, Eivind},
biburl = {https://puma.ub.uni-stuttgart.de/bibtex/2f00c070a260ea2e9a2eca96dda6f0924/diglezakis},
doi = {10.1371/journal.pcbi.1003285},
interhash = {f3617952fb4dc7d1497ed5f8b31c4e69},
intrahash = {f00c070a260ea2e9a2eca96dda6f0924},
journal = {PLOS Computational Biology},
keywords = {forschungsdaten litQSaFE medizin reproducibility software softwareLizenzMotivation},
month = {10},
number = 10,
pages = {1-4},
publisher = {Public Library of Science},
timestamp = {2018-08-22T15:26:06.000+0200},
title = {Ten Simple Rules for Reproducible Computational Research},
url = {https://doi.org/10.1371/journal.pcbi.1003285},
volume = 9,
year = 2013
}